本文目录导读:
随着互联网的飞速发展,网站已经成为人们获取信息、交流互动的重要平台,而导航网站作为连接用户与各类网站的桥梁,其重要性不言而喻,本文将深入剖析Win8导航网站源码,从架构、功能实现等方面进行详细解读,以期为开发者提供有益的参考。
Win8导航网站架构
1、技术选型
Win8导航网站采用HTML5、CSS3、JavaScript等前端技术,以及Node.js、Express、MongoDB等后端技术,前端采用响应式设计,适应不同终端设备;后端采用模块化设计,提高代码复用性和可维护性。
2、系统架构
图片来源于网络,如有侵权联系删除
Win8导航网站采用分层架构,主要分为以下几个层次:
(1)表现层:负责展示网站页面,包括HTML、CSS、JavaScript等。
(2)业务逻辑层:负责处理用户请求,实现业务功能,如搜索、分类、推荐等。
(3)数据访问层:负责与数据库进行交互,实现数据的增删改查。
(4)数据库层:存储网站数据,如网站信息、分类信息、推荐信息等。
Win8导航网站功能实现
1、网站首页
(1)响应式布局:适应不同终端设备,提供良好的用户体验。
(2)搜索功能:支持关键词搜索,快速定位所需网站。
图片来源于网络,如有侵权联系删除
(3)分类展示:按分类展示网站,方便用户浏览。
(4)推荐展示:根据用户浏览习惯,推荐相关网站。
2、网站搜索
(1)关键词匹配:对用户输入的关键词进行匹配,展示相关网站。
(2)排序算法:根据网站权重、点击量等因素,对搜索结果进行排序。
(3)分页显示:对搜索结果进行分页展示,提高用户体验。
3、网站分类
(1)分类展示:按分类展示网站,方便用户浏览。
图片来源于网络,如有侵权联系删除
(2)分类搜索:支持分类内搜索,提高搜索效率。
4、网站推荐
(1)推荐算法:根据用户浏览习惯、网站权重等因素,推荐相关网站。
(2)推荐展示:展示推荐网站,吸引用户点击。
通过对Win8导航网站源码的剖析,我们可以了解到其采用的技术选型、系统架构以及功能实现,该网站在满足用户需求的同时,也具有一定的可扩展性和可维护性,对于开发者来说,借鉴Win8导航网站源码,有助于提高自己的技术水平,为用户提供更好的网站体验。
标签: #win8导航网站源码
评论列表